In the past seven days residents have experienced a temperature range of nearly 70 degrees, from minus 12 degrees on Jan. 30 to 56 degrees on Feb. 3 and 4.
During that period we experienced .29 inches of rain and 2.65 inches of snow. Information provided by Guy Verhoff, Pandora weather observer.
Ohio Northern University students are assisting with the annual “Night to Shine” prom event for people with special needs from 6 p.m. to 9 p.m. on Feb. 8 at Lima First Church, 1660 Findlay Road, Lima.
It is anticipated more than 140 individuals will attend the event, and approximately 150 ONU students will be involved in the evening. They include students from areas such as Greek Life, Sigma Iota Epsilon management honor fraternity, the football team, religious life and education majors.
Each ONU student has a buddy for the event, and all come dressed in prom apparel for the big night out.
OTC Markets Group Inc., today announced Liberty Bancshares Inc., the holding company for Liberty National Bank, headquartered in Ada, has qualified to trade on the OTCQX Best Market. Liberty Bancshares were previously privately-held.
The OTCQX is the top tier of the three marketplaces for the over-the-counter trading of stocks.
Liberty Bancshares begins trading under the symbol “LBSI.” Financial disclosure and Real-Time Level 2 quotes for the company are on www.otcmarkets.com.

The Ada girls basketball team received a first round bye and was seeded 12th out of 12 teams at the Allen East/Bath Div. IV super sectional drawing held Sunday afternoon.
The Lady Bulldogs (1-17) will face the first round winner between top-seeded Arlington and 11th-seeded Hardin Northern Saturday, Feb. 23, at 6:15 p.m. in Harrod at Allen East.
Ada and fifth-seeded Leipsic both got first round byes for the six-team half of the sectional at AE.
Third seed Bluffton will meet 10th seed Pandora-Gilboa in the second sectional semifinal at AE. The winner then plays Leipsic in the other sectional final Saturday, Feb. 23.
